Reporting to the Maintenance Manager you will be responsible for attending assigned visits to customer sites and premises to perform appropriate and scheduled electrical and mechanical maintenance, fault diagnoses and repair of fire suppression detection systems The role will be responsible for covering clients Nation Wide (however a large core of these are based in the Midlands and London locations). Candidates will be required to travel extensively (Nationally) and will require the ability to stay away from home as necessary. Package Details £40,000 to £45,000 Company Van (fully equipped), Fuel Card, Mobile Phone & Laptop / Tablet Expenses for Overnight Stays & Daily Meal Allowance 24 Days Annual Leave & Bank Holidays Pension & Death in Service Requirements Previous experience in a similar role working on Fire Detection and Suppression Systems Experience of Water Mist Fire Suppression Systems and Detection systems, alongside a strong understanding and knowledge of the wider fire prevention sector Full UK Driving License Be educated to NVQ Level 3 and ideally hold 17th Edition Certification Ability to communicate directly with customers and maintain good relationships Proficient in the use of mobile technologies (Smart phones, Tablets) Have passed or able to pass the CSCS Health & Safety Test (Holds a relevant CSCS or related scheme competency card preferable) Able to work and stay away from home and, if necessary, to do so at short notice when needed. LIVE WITHIN A 1.5 HOUR COMMUTE OF NORWICH Key Responsibilities On receipt of assigned work schedule ensure all necessary equipment and service kits to conduct the assigned work is available and on works van. Liaise with the office for additional supplies where necessary. Maintain a professional relationship with customers and their staff Perform all maintenance and repair work thoroughly, in a safe manner, and in accordance with all laid down service instructions. Ensuring system items removed from customer premises are labelled as necessary to identify the part and issue and returned to office. Ensure all paperwork, whether in hard copy or required to be completed via an issued tablet/iPad, in respect of each job is completed properly and is received by the office in a timely manner and in good condition. Report all callouts to the Office as soon as possible. During nominated call out periods ensure phone is kept on and is responded to in a timely fashion. On receipt of call out schedule keep nominated call out dates free of holiday and other commitments and notify the office immediately of any perceived conflicts. Maintaining allocated service vehicle in a good condition and for performing all daily and weekly checks, and for ensuring completed check sheets are received by the office in a timely manner Ensure all work equipment is maintained, including Ladder checks and tags, PAT testing, Calibrations, and associated pre-use checks. Complete all assigned training courses within timeframe allocated. You are responsible for ensuring that all CSCS cards, similar scheme or competency cards that you are required to hold are maintained. Observe all company QHSE policies, procedures and other instructions and ensure all concerns observed or reported are submitted to the QHSE Compliance department. Notify the office without delay of any incidents, near misses or H&S concerns.
